Position Summary
The Freight Broker I plays a pivotal role in sourcing optimal carrier solutions for transportation requirements within designated domestic regions across the United States for ODW customers. Reporting directly to the Brokerage - Region Lead, this role will collaborate within the Regional Team framework to ensure ODW effectively meets the demands of both customers and carriers, fostering successful partnerships and operational excellence.
Essential Responsibilities
- Use historical data to maximize short- and long-term profitability by covering freight at optimal profit levels
- Accurately measure count and percentage of loads covered and given back to ensure business performs within goal rate
- Provide assistance in carrier vetting with Fraud Protection on new carrier onboarding
- Assist with maintenance of current carrier relationships
- Ability to negotiate freight costs with carriers
- Assist your assigned region and maintain effective communication with carriers
- Assist with communicating market trends and pricing
- All other duties as assigned
